Friends, Milady's oldest brother, Vince, is ill and probably dying. He beat the throat cancer a long time ago, but a new cancer has cropped up, and it seems there's nothing to be done.

Lost my cousin Sherry some weeks back. Milady's cousin Pat suddenly died from leukemia more recently. Our generation is hitting the wall, although really none of them was that old. (Of course, I go by the standard of my 95yo mother.)

Vince was best known as a longtime bartender on Chicago's North Side. (Can be an honorable position.) He truly was a gentle giant, impressive in height and girth. I remember him walking a drunk out the door of the bar one day, firmly, but so nicely the drunk thanked him. Conversely, Vince talks of getting booted from a bar himself, and tipping the bouncer. Heh - bar culture was something I had to learn in our Chicago years.

I also will always remember one day when I sat down at his bar in a time of trouble. He said I was the saddest looking person he'd ever seen. (For a longtime big city bartender, that's saying something!) Then he helped me find the solution I needed. And he probably bought me a beer. He did so much for so many as is broadly loved.

Vince is also a painter, musician, and writer. I'll try to post about his book on the book thread some Sunday soon. Been meaning to for a long time. Vince was in the Navy during Nam, radio guy. Also an excellent chef. Husband and father, he's leaving his devoted wife and their one beautiful adult child, my daughter's age.

Milady's family is large and scattered. There was a plan for relatives to gather and visit Vince, but all my daughter's cousins were coming and it was becoming a circus in a sick room. They were discouraging the en masse party when he took a turn for the worse, which if he doesn't improve, means he may not last the week. So, instead of going up to visit, we may have to go up for a funeral.

So, one way or another, Milady and I will probably be driving up to Chicago this week. Prayers welcomed where applicable.
